Mixed leaf salad with hazelnut dressing

Elevate your meal with a fresh, mixed leaf salad topped with a deliciously nutty hazelnut dressing. This easy-to-make recipe combines crunchy hazelnuts, mixed greens, and a delightful blend of olive oil, vinegar, and a hint of sugar for the perfect balance of flavors.

30 Mar 2025
Cook time 5 min
Prep time 10 min

Ingredients:

2 tbsp hazelnuts
2 cups mixed greens (or salad mix)
1/4 cup olive oil
1 tbsp vinegar
1 tsp sugar

Instructions:

1. Toast the Hazelnuts:
- Preheat a small skillet over medium heat.
- Add the hazelnuts to the skillet and toast them, stirring frequently, until they become aromatic and slightly golden, around 5-7 minutes.
- Once toasted, remove the hazelnuts from the skillet, transfer them to a cutting board, and let them cool for a few minutes.
- Coarsely chop the hazelnuts once they’ve cooled.
2. Prepare the Dressing:
- In a small bowl, combine the olive oil, vinegar, and sugar.
- Whisk the ingredients together until the sugar is fully dissolved and the dressing is well combined.
3. Assemble the Salad:
- Place the mixed greens in a large salad bowl.
- Drizzle the hazelnut dressing over the greens.
- Toss the salad gently to make sure the greens are evenly coated with the dressing.
4. Add the Hazelnuts:
- Sprinkle the chopped, toasted hazelnuts over the salad.
- Give the salad a final, gentle toss to incorporate the hazelnuts.
5. Serve:
- Serve the salad immediately as a fresh starter or side dish.

Tips:

- Toast the hazelnuts in a dry skillet over medium heat for about 5 minutes, shaking the pan regularly to prevent burning, to enhance their flavor and crunch.

- You can substitute the mixed greens with any salad greens of your choice, such as spinach, arugula, or kale.

- For a more intense flavor, let the dressing sit for about 10 minutes before mixing it with the salad.

- Add some extra toppings like cherry tomatoes, cucumber slices, or avocado for additional texture and flavor.

- To evenly coat the salad, add the dressing gradually while tossing the greens.
